Output 7706cc77ef0e4c1be17e27fc6ab4286242141894040ba0ed39ffa95c22874c16:0

value
150175
script pubkey
OP_0 OP_PUSHBYTES_20 43188402a8f78197f56ee2a2a42161a01cbf5255
address
bc1qgvvggq4g77qe0atwu232ggtp5qwt75j4le7qec
transaction
7706cc77ef0e4c1be17e27fc6ab4286242141894040ba0ed39ffa95c22874c16
confirmations
65275
spent
true